Sehnsa

Sehnsa is a small city & sub-divisional headquarter in the District Kotli in Azad Kashmir.Sehnsa is very well connected the to many other parts of Azad Kashmir as well as Pakistan. It is located at a lower level in the valley. it is a picturesque city, where nearby dwells forests and a landscape of natural beauty attracts the visitors.

    Raja Sensphal Khan was the grandson of Raja Mangarpal and he established the City of Sehnsa which is now one of the largest town’s in the Pakistan side of Kashmir known as Azad Kashir (AJK). Raja Sens Pal the grandson of Raja Mangar Pal was the first mangral to convert to Islam and was given the title Khan meaning ruler. The Mangral's have carried this title since together with the title of Raja. Raja Sensphal Khan had four sons from whom all the Mangral trace their origins: 1. Raja Raheem Khan (settled in Malot) 2. Raja Daan Khan (settled in Sehnsa) 3. Raja Shahstra Khan (settled in Bratla) 4. Raja Menda Khan
